Latest from the OSCE Special Monitoring Mission to Ukraine (SMM), based on information received as of 19:30, 12 December 2017
Publishing date: 13 December 2017
Content type: Daily report
Where we are: OSCE Special Monitoring Mission to Ukraine (closed)
What we do: Conflict prevention and resolution
The SMM recorded a similar number of ceasefire violations in Donetsk region and more in Luhansk region compared with the previous reporting period. The Mission followed up on reports of a civilian casualty from Dokuchaievsk. The SMM observed damage to a powerline in Avdiivka resulting in a lack of electricity in central Avdiivka. The SMM continued monitoring the disengagement areas near Stanytsia Luhanska, Zolote and Petrivske and recorded ceasefire violations near all three. Its access remained restricted there and elsewhere, including near Debaltseve and Kozatske.* The SMM saw weapons in violation of withdrawal lines near Miusynsk. The Mission facilitated and monitored repairs and maintenance of essential infrastructure near Artema and Zalizne. The SMM visited four border areas outside of government control...
OSCE Mission to Montenegro supports development of Local Environmental Action Plan
Publishing date: 13 December 2017
Content type: News
Where we are: OSCE Mission to Montenegro
What we do: Environmental activities, Environmental good governance
The development of local-level strategy documents for the handling of environmental matters – so-called Local Environmental Action Plans (LEAPs) – was the focus of a two-day workshop organized by the OSCE Mission to Montenegro in Podgorica on 7 and 8 December. LEAPs have the objective of enabling municipal authorities to handle environmental matters for which they are responsible in a more effective, sustainable and transparent manner.

OSCE Mission to Montenegro organizes joint regional meeting of border police Montenegro and Albania
Publishing date: 13 December 2017
A fourth regional working meeting for the joint border police patrol border guards of Albania and Montenegro, organized by the OSCE Mission to Montenegro in co-operation with the OSCE Presence in Albania, the Montenegrin Interior Ministry’s Border Police and the Border and Migration Police of the Republic of Albania, took place on 11 December 2017 in Kolašin, Montenegro.
OSCE organizes study visit to Serbia for Tajik state officials
Publishing date: 13 December 2017
Content type: News
Where we are: OSCE Programme Office in Dushanbe
What we do: Human rights, Good governance
A study visit for high level Tajik state officials to Belgrade was organized by the OSCE Programme Office in Dushanbe in co-operation with the OSCE Mission to Serbia from 6 to 10 December 2017. A group of ten representatives from various state institutions such as the national parliament, the Presidential Office, the General Prosecutor’s Office, the Committee on Women and Family Affairs and several ministries took part in the visit.
